Œil-de-Perdrix AOC Valais
A wine produced from Pinot Noir grapes which are Burgundian origin.
Tasting notes
The nose firstly evokes a fragrance of elderberry which is then joined by a subtle scent of raspberry and strawberry. These aromatic nuances can also be detected on the palate and even in the exceptionally long finish. Its marked acidity gives it a great fruitiness and liveliness. You'll want more!
Food-wine pairing
Ideal with mushrooms in cream sauce, veal chops à la crème, veal sweetbreads, cold meat, roast chicken, guinea fowl, rabbit, summer dishes and blue cheeses.
